Test R: The Safety Belt Warning Indicator Is Never/Always On

PINPOINT TEST R: THE SAFETY BELT WARNING INDICATOR IS NEVER/ALWAYS ON

Normal Operation
The restraints control module (RCM) monitors the safety belt position through the safety belt buckle switch. The RCM provides the safety belt buckle status to the instrument cluster over the high speed controller area network (HS-CAN) communication bus. If the instrument cluster does not receive the safety belt buckle switch status from the RCM for greater than 5 seconds, the instrument cluster sets DTC U0151 and defaults the safety belt warning indicator off. If the RCM message is deemed invalid by the instrument cluster for greater than 5 seconds, the instrument cluster sets DTC U2023 and defaults the safety belt warning indicator off.

This pinpoint test is intended to diagnose the following:
- RCM
- Instrument cluster
